WebUnder Massachusetts's and Washington's PFML statutes, however, the tax liability appears to be imposed only on the employer, with a limited permission to recover some portion from its employees. If the employer does not seek to recover that portion, these statutes appear not to impose any tax liability on the affected employee. WebThe Massachusetts Paid Family and Medical Leave (“MA PFML”) is a state law that took effect January 1, 2024. It requires most Massachusetts employers to provide paid … Web07. jun 2024. · For example, Massachusetts has a Paid Family Medical Leave Act (PFML). Unlike FMLA, to be eligible to receive paid leave under PFML, a worker only must have earned at least $5,400 in the previous 12 months.
